Bulls say

Triumph Financial is currently experiencing a freight recession that could have a negative impact on its factoring and payment revenue streams. However, we believe the company's investments in its fintech offerings, such as LoadPay and Intelligence, will drive strong EPS growth in the coming years. Additionally, the company is showing signs of improving margins and revenue growth in its transportation-related segments. Based on these factors, we have a positive outlook for Triumph Financial's stock.

Bears say

Triumph Financial is currently underperforming due to its significant investment spending into new offerings, as well as a strong market that has already priced in potential earnings recovery. While the Payments segment is experiencing growth, the company's LoadPay product shows promising user and revenue growth, but it remains to be seen if it can sustain it. Additionally, while the Banking segment remains profitable, its net interest income has declined and loan balances are expected to stay relatively flat. These factors lead to a negative outlook on Triumph Financial's stock.
